Clindacin Gel Side Effects (Nuksanat)
Clindacin Gel (Clindamycin Phosphate) is generally safe when taken at the correct dose. However, like all medicines, it can cause side effects in some patients.
Common Side Effects (Aam Nuksanat)
- Skin dryness
- Burning or stinging sensation
- Skin peeling
These side effects are usually mild. If they continue, inform your doctor.

Warnings and Precautions (Ihtiyat)
- Don't use Clindacin Gel if you are allergic to Clindamycin, Lincomycin, or any ingredients
- Have a history of ulcerative colitis
- Have a history of regional enteritis
